The was a expanded remake of the original Game Boy Advance title, released as a limited-time free download on DSiWare and the 3DS eShop to celebrate the series' 25th anniversary. While the original game required at least two players and hardware like GBA Link Cables, this edition introduced several features that remain exclusive to this specific version and are often sought after in ROM format because the game was delisted in 2014.
